在assemblyinfo.cs中,我有assemblyversion和assemblyfileversion。
通常我只是像这样增加assemblyversion。
第1位:重大变化
第2位:微小变化
第3位:错误修复
第4位:Subversion版本号
但是,我想知道assemblyfileversion用于什么,何时需要增加。它应该与assemblyversion相同吗?
如果我不使用它,我应该直接评论它吗?
非常感谢你的建议,

最佳答案

assembly version由.net类加载器使用,并标识程序集的.net版本。AssemblyFileversion表示包含在Windows PE文件的标准版本信息块中的文件版本…换句话说,它表示在“文件属性”对话框中看到的文件版本。
如果省略assemblyfileversion,编译器将默认它与assemblyversion相同。

08-06 18:56